Information extracted from the school's own website
"WOODFIELD: A place where we belong and are inspired to succeed and thrive."
Head Teacher Kate Hallam welcomes visitors and describes Woodfield as a large, growing school in Balby, part of The Rose Learning Trust. She states it is a happy, safe and friendly school with a highly inclusive ethos, aiming for excellence so every child can achieve. Staff are highly skilled and go the extra mile to ensure productive, enjoyable learning and holistic development. The school embraces change and aims to provide the best possible start in life.
Clubs
Breakfast Club and After School Clubs are available.
